Output ecba602ec20aab3a984dfbf73f1a4e70029e2c7f1bccdbf65ba2a579c84db17b:5
- value
- 905469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2335bcb4ac7b20566cc18848a0a724a11c2ddf27 OP_EQUAL
- address
- 34uBwykGiKqsSxoha8fTo7MfcX79MtAZEG
- transaction
- ecba602ec20aab3a984dfbf73f1a4e70029e2c7f1bccdbf65ba2a579c84db17b
- confirmations
- 256132
- spent
- true